T- <br />Note: Never received an original. <br />)U Gld <br />C <br />C 01 )Y <br />ORDINANCE N0. 89- .- <br />INTRODUCED BY: Mayor Carmen and Council as a Whole <br />AN ORDINANCE <br />ENACTING CHAPTER 1389 OF THE CODIFIED <br />ORDINANCES OF MAYFIELD VILLAGE ENTITLED <br />"REGULATED USES" <br />WHEREAS, Council of Mayfield Village desires to enact regulations per- <br />taining to certain business uses within the Village; and <br />WHEREAS, Council also desires to create equitable procedures for the <br />regulation of such uses. <br />B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F MAYFIELD VILLAGE, OHIO, THAT: <br />SECTION 1. That Chapter 1389 of the Codified Ordinances of Mayfield <br />Village be enacted to read as follows: <br />"CHAPTER 1389 <br />REGULATED USES <br />1389.01 Purpose 1389.03 Location regulations <br />1389.02 Definitions 1389.04 Waiver provisions <br />1389.01 PURPOSE. <br />In the enactment, execution and enforcement of this title, it is recog- <br />nized that there are certain uses which, due to the nature of their operation, <br />are recognized as having seriously objectionable operational characteristics, <br />particularly when several of said uses are concentrated in close proximity to <br />each other thereby having a detrimental effect upon the surrounding area. The <br />regulation of these uses is necessary to insure the detrimental effects will <br />not contribute to the blighting, downgrading or other diminution of property <br />values of the surrounding neighborhood. The primary purpose of these regula- <br />tions is to prevent a concentration of these uses in any one (1) area. Uses <br />subject to these controls are: <br />(a) Adult Book store; <br />(b) Adult motion picture theater; <br />(c) Adult peep show; <br />(d) Massage establishment. <br />1389.02 DEFINITIONS. <br />(a) Adult Book Store.
